Concrete Sealing in Renton, WA
Concrete sealing services involve applying a protective coating to existing concrete surfaces to help pr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ear. This service is commonly requested for driveways, patios, walkways, garage floors, and decorative concrete features. Property owners typically seek concrete sealing to enhance the durability of their surfaces, maintain their appearance, and reduce the need for repairs over time. Before requesting sealing,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the concrete, including any cracks or surface deterioration, as well as the type of finish or existing coatings that may affect the sealing process.
Homeowners considering concrete sealing should also be aware of the different types of sealers available, such as penetrating or surface-applied options, and how each may impact the look and longevity of the surface. Proper surface preparation, including cleaning and repairing any damage, is essential for optimal results. It’s recommended to inquire about the appropriate sealing products for specific projects and to confirm that the concrete is fully cured and dry before application. This service can help preserve the integrity and appearance of concrete surfaces for years to come.

Concrete Sealing Questions
What is concrete sealing? Concrete sealing involves applying a protective layer to concrete surfaces to pr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ear.
Which projects benefit from concrete sealing? Dri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ors are common projects that benefit from sealing to enhance durability and appearance.
How often should concrete be sealed? Typically, concrete should be resealed every 2 to 3 years to maintain protection and appearance.
Does sealing improve concrete’s appearance? Yes, sealing can enhance the color and finish of concrete, giving it a cleaner and more polished look.
